- /*
- * Statistics are used to store timestamps, time periods, counts memory usage and any other interesting statistic
- * which is collected as the query is built or executed.
- *
- * Each statistic has the following details:
- *
- * Creator - Which component created the statistic. This should be the name of the component instance i.e., "mythor_x_y" rather than the type ("thor").
- * - It can also be used to represent a subcomponent e.g., mythor:0 the master, mythor:10 means the 10th slave.
- * ?? Is the sub component always numeric ??
- *
- * Kind - The specific kind of the statistic - uses a global enumeration. (Engines can locally use different ranges of numbers and map them to the global enumeration).
- *
- * Measure - What kind of statistic is it? It can always be derived from the kind. The following values are supported:
- * time - elapsed time in nanoseconds
- * timestamp/when - a point in time (?to the nanosecond?)
- * count - a count of the number of occurrences
- * memory/size - a quantity of memory (or disk) measured in kb
- * load - measure of cpu activity (stored as 1/1000000 core)
- * skew - a measure of skew. 10000 = perfectly balanced, range [0..infinity]
- *
- *Optional:
- *
- * Description - Purely for display, calculated if not explicitly supplied.
- * Scope - Where in the execution of the task is statistic gathered? It can have multiple levels (separated by colons), and statistics for
- * a given level can be retrieved independently. The following scopes are supported:
- * "global" - the default if not specified. Globally/within a workunit.
- * "wfid<n>" - within workflow item <n> (is this at all useful?)
- * "graphn[:sg<n>[:ac<n>"]"
- * Possibly additional levels to allow multiple instances of an activity when used in a graph etc.
- *
- * Target - The target of the thing being monitored. E.g., a filename. ?? Is this needed? Should this be combined with scope??
- *
- * Examples:
- * creator(mythor),scope(),kind(TimeWall) total time spend processing in thor search ct(thor),scope(),kind(TimeWall)
- * creator(mythor),scope(graph1),kind(TimeWall) - total time spent processing a graph
- * creator(mythor),scope(graph1:sg<subid>),kind(TimeElapsed) - total time spent processing a subgraph
- * creator(mythor),scope(graph1:sg<n>:ac<id>),kind(TimeElapsed) - time for activity from start to stop
- * creator(mythor),scope(graph1:sg<n>:ac<id>),kind(TimeLocal) - time spent locally processing
- * creator(mythor),scope(graph1:sg<n>:ac<id>),kind(TimeWallRowRange) - time from first row to last row
- * creator(mythor),scope(graph1:sg<n>:ac<id>),kind(WhenFirstRow) - timestamp for first row
- * creator(myeclccserver@myip),scope(compile),kind(TimeWall)
- * creator(myeclccserver@myip),scope(compile:transform),kind(TimeWall)
- * creator(myeclccserver@myip),scope(compile:transform:fold),kind(TimeWall)
- *
- * Other possibilities
- * creator(myesp),scope(filefile::abc::def),kind(NumAccesses)
- *
- * Configuring statistic collection:
- * - Each engine allows the statistics being collected to be specified. You need to configure the area (time/memory/disk/), the level of detail by component and location.
- *
- * Some background notes:
- * - Start time and end time (time processing first and last record) is useful for detecting time skew/serial activities.
- * - Information is lost if you only show final skew, rather than skew over time, but storing time series data is
- * prohibitive so we may need to create some derived metrics.
- * - The engines need options to control what information is gathered.
- * - Need to ensure clocks are synchronized for the timestamps to be useful.
- *
- * Some typical analysis we want to perform:
- * - Activities that show significant skew between first (or last) record times between nodes.
- * - Activities where the majority of the time is being spent.
- *
- * Filtering statistics - with control over who is creating it, what is being recorded, and
- * [in order of importance]
- * - which level of creator you are interested in [summary or individual nodes, or both] (*;*:*)?
- * - which level of scope (interested in activities, or just by graph, or both)
- * - a particular kind of statistic
- * - A particular creator (including fixed/wildcarded sub-component)
- *
- * => Provide a class for representing a filter, which can be used to filter when recording and retrieving. Start simple and then extend.
- * Text representation creator(*,*:*),creatordepth(n),creatorkind(x),scopedepth(n),scopekind(xxx,yyy),scope(*:23),kind(x).
- *
- * Examples
- * kind(TimeElapsed),scopetype(subgraph) - subgraph timings
- * kind(Time*),scopedepth(1)&kind(TimeElapsed),scopedepth(2),scopetype(subgraph) - all legacy global timings.
- * creatortype(thor),kind(TimeElapsed),scope("") - how much time has been spent on thor? (Need to sum?)
- * creator(mythor),kind(TimeElapsed),scope("") - how much time has been spent on *this* thor.
- * kind(TimeElapsed),scope("compiled") - how much time has been spent on *this* thor.
- *
- * Need to efficiently
- * - Get all (simple) stats for a graph/activities (creator(*),kind(*),scope(x:*)) - display in graph, finding hotspots
- * - Get all stats for an activity (creator(*:*),measure(*:*),scope(x:y)) - providing details in a graph
- * - Merge stats from multiple components
- * - Merge stats from multiple runs?
- *
- * Bulk updates will tend to be for a given component and should only need minor processing (e.g. patch ids) or no processing to update/combine.
- * - You need to be able to filter only a certain level of statistic - e.g., times for transforms, but not details of those transforms.
- *
- * => suggest store as
- * stats[creatorDepth,scopeDepth][creator] { kind, scope, value, target }. sorted by (scope, target, kind)
- * - allows high level filtering by level
- * - allows combining with minor updates.
- * - possibly extra structure within each creator - maybe depending on the level of the scope
- * - need to be sub-sorted to allow efficient merging between creators (e.g. for calculating skew)
- * - possibly different structure when collecting [e.g., indexed by stat, or using a local stat mapping ] and storing.
- *
- * Use (local) tables to map scope->uid. Possibly implicitly defined on first occurrence, or zip the entire structure.
- *
- * The progress information should be stored compressed, with min,max child ids to avoid decompressing
- */
